1990 740 Turbo White Smoke after 10 min drive then no smoke? 700 1990

My wife allowed our 740 to idle in the driveway until she was ready to go to work (idled about 5 min or so), when she arrived at work after about a 10 min drive a chemically smelling white smoke came from unter the front of the car driver side. SHe reported that it didn't overheat and no oil loss. She completed a few trips the rest of the day and I drove it hard for 20 min last night and there were no issues. The only thing out of sorts was that the coolant resv. was abit low; however, it didn't take much coolant to get it back ut to MAX. The car sat for about 4 days without running, could collant have dripped and collected somewhere to burn off or maybe there was a plactic bag or someting buring?
